  • Dwarf planet discovered beyond Neptune

    Dwarf planet discovered beyond Neptune

    July 11, 2016 19:48 Hot Recent News

    An international team of astronomers has discovered a new dwarf planet in the outer reaches of our solar system. The object of roughly 700 kilometers, until a name is specified designated RR245, is part of the belt 'lumps of ice' far beyond Neptune. The discovery was made with the telescope on Mauna Kea volcano in Hawaii

  • President of South Sudan ordered cease-fire

    President of South Sudan ordered cease-fire

    juba July 11, 2016 18:12 Hot Recent News

    The president of South Sudan Salva Kiir, the soldiers of his army SPLA Monday instructed to lay down their arms. He still said to be ready to work with his rival Riek Machar, the current vice president. In recent days threatened fierce firefights in capital Juba to pay the young African country back into civil war.
